    Overview of Chamber Music musician Lévon Minassian

    French musician Lévon Minassian is well-known for his work in chamber and classical music. He has achieved fame in the music industry thanks to his unrivaled proficiency with the double-reed woodwind instrument duduk. songs lovers love him because of the soul, emotion, and evocation in his songs.

    The melodies in Minassian's song are a tasteful fusion of modern and traditional Armenian music. He has performed on many stages all over the world, enthralling audiences with his fervor, accuracy, and innovation. His deeply ingrained cultural heritage is reflected in his music, and he has contributed significantly to the promotion of Armenian music on a global scale.

    What are the most popular songs for Chamber Music musician Lévon Minassian?

    French artist Lévon Minassian, who specializes in classical and chamber music, has a few well-known songs. With its eerie duduk tune and Middle Eastern influence, "Bab' Aziz" stands out as a special song. Another favorite is "Hovern' engan," which has a sad yet lovely tune. The peppy song "Tchinares" has vivacious percussion and a relentless tempo.

    Some of Minassian's other well-known songs are "Ar intch lav er," "Siretzi Yares Daran (They Have Taken the One I Love)," "Im ayrogh veuchtitz," "Araksi artassouken," "Oror," "Hol Ara Yeze (Call of the Earth)," and "Echremet." Each of these compositions demonstrates Minassian's proficiency with the duduk and his capacity to meld many musical genres and traditions.

    Which are the most important collaborations with other musicians for Chamber Music musician Lévon Minassian?

    On various songs, including "Bab' Aziz," "Oror," "Echremet," "Sari artchig," and "The Dead Seas," Lévon Minassian and Armand Amar worked together. "Bab' Aziz," which features Minassian's duduk playing and Amar's orchestration, is one of the noteworthy collaborations. The end result is a hauntingly beautiful artwork that highlights both artists' best work. The song is a standout from the soundtrack to the film with the same name because of its cinematic quality.

    "Oror" is another notable joint effort. Minassian plays the duduk on this piece, which is a lullaby, and Amar plays the piano. The two instruments work together to create a calming and peaceful ambiance, which is ideal for the lullaby's intended use. The song is a part of the collection "Armenia: Lullabies & Dances," which includes traditional Armenian music that Amar has adapted and that is performed by a range of musicians.
